As per my suggestion, after 15yrs try to settle in one company, also start working on some passive income source, that you can convert to your regular income incase you want to move from your regular jobs.
Mostly in IT industry, there are very less people who have more than 40-45+ age and doing job for others, either they start their own something or they invest in some different start-up.
So I would suggest, start saving some money for future and after 10-15yrs of experience, start creating your own something in parallel. Once you establish completely then leave your regular job and focus on your own business.
